/****************** BESPOKE CSS FOR HASTINGS BOROUGH COUNCIL ***************/

.container3SC {
    padding-bottom: 80px;
}


.container3SC h1, .container3SC legend, .container3SC .NavBarTableCell, .container3SC .NavBarLink, .container3SC h2 {
	color: #333333;
}

/* style input and links as buttons */

.container3SC .button3sc,
.container3SC input.button3sc,
.container3SC a.button3sc,
.container3SC .smallButton3sc,
.container3SC input.smallButton3sc,
.container3SC a.smallButton3sc,
.container3SC #uploadBtn {
    float: left;

    background-color: #00a651;
    border: 1px solid #00a651;
    color: #ffffff;

    transition: all .4s;
}

.button3sc {
    min-width: 135px;
}

.button3sc,
input.button3sc,
a.button3sc {
    padding: .5em 2em .55em;
    cursor: pointer;
    font-weight: bold;
    color: #ffffff;
    text-transform: uppercase;
    font-size: 18px;
    font-family: 'Source Sans Pro', sans-serif;
}

.button3sc:hover,
input.button3sc:hover,
a.button3sc:hover,
.smallbutton3sc:hover,
input.smallbutton3sc:hover,
a.smallbutton3sc:hover {
    /* colour #00a651 - 80% transparency */
    background-color: rgba(0, 166, 81, 0.8);
    border: 1px solid #00a651 ;
}

.button3sc:focus,
input.button3sc:focus,
a.button3sc:focus,
.smallbutton3sc:focus,
input.smallbutton3sc:focus,
a.smallbutton3sc:focus {
    background-color: #00a651 ;
    border: 1px solid #00a651 ;
}

.button3sc:active,
input.button3sc:active,
a.button3sc:active,
.smallbutton3sc:active,
input.smallbutton3sc:active,
a.smallbutton3sc:active {
    background-color: #00a651 ;
    border: 1px solid #00a651 ;
}

@media only screen and (min-width: 730px)
{
   .site-header__inner {
       max-width: 1000px;
   }
}

.container3SC {
    padding-bottom: 90px;
}

a[href="SendEmail.aspx"] {
    height: 20px;
}

form[name="frmProceed"] {
    /* margin-top: -60px;  */
}


input[name="btnProceed"] {
    /* margin-top: 20px; */
}


form[name="frmDelete"] {
    margin-left: 10px;
    margin-top: -10px;
}


#uploadspanBtn {
	padding: 6px 5px;
	margin-bottom: 0 !important;
	font-size: 16px !important;
}

input[value="Add"].smallButton3sc {
    float:none;
    padding: 6px 12px;
    margin-bottom: 0 !important;
	font-size: 16px !important;
    cursor: pointer;
}

input[value="Add"].smallButton3sc:hover,
input[value="Remove"].smallButton3sc:hover,
#uploadBtn:hover,
#uploadspanBtn:hover {
    /* background-color: #692D73 ; */
    filter: brightness(120%)
    cursor: pointer;
}

input[value="Remove"].smallButton3sc {
    padding: 6px 12px;
    margin-bottom: 0 !important;
	font-size: 16px !important;
    float: left;
    /* padding: 8px 12px; */
    /* margin-bottom: 0 !important; */
    /* margin-top: .75em; */
	/* font-size: 16px !important; */
	/* vertical-align: initial; */
}


input[Value="Proceed"] {
    height: 53px;
}

/****************************************************************************************/
.headerbar {
    margin-top: 20px;
    width: 100%;
    height: 12px;
    background-color: #02AFF3;
}

.span12 p {
    font-size: 14px !important;
    color: #FFFFFF !important;
}


